We are seeking a skilled Welder/Fabricator to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for fabricating, assembling, and welding metal components according to engineering drawings and specifications while maintaining high standards of quality and safety.
Key Responsibilities
Read and interpret technical drawings, blueprints, and specifications.
Measure, cut, shape, and assemble metal materials.
Perform MIG, TIG, and/or Stick welding as required.
Fabricate structural steel, metalwork, and custom components.
Operate fabrication equipment such as grinders, drills, saws, and presses.
Inspect completed work to ensure quality and compliance with specifications.
Repair and modify existing metal structures and equipment.
Maintain a clean and safe work environment. Follow workplace health and safety procedures at all times.
Collaborate with supervisors, engineers, and other tradespeople to complete projects on schedule.
